How do you decide between shared hosting or dedicated hosting plans? If your site is large or complex, or you receive a lot of traffic, shared hosting might limit your ability to expand and meet the needs of your customers adequately. If this is the case, you are better off with dedicated hosting.

When choosing a web host, pick a company that is located within your niche’s country. For example, if your target market resides within Germany, it is in your best interest to select a provider that operates a data center from within the country’s borders.

Is free hosting something you’ve been contemplating? Be especially diligent in backing up your files, because most free hosts do not provide that service. That is just part of the price of saving money on website hosting. If your site goes down, loses a page, etc., you’re not going to get any help from your host.

Check and see if your host offers the option of having a secure server for your customers. This will give you the ability to put a small button on your site letting visitors know that your site is secure and safe for transactions, including personal data or financial information.

The amount that web hosts charge for service packages depends upon how much traffic your site receives. Ask your host how your bill will be computed. You may find that you are going to be billed a flat rate or based on the traffic that your site experiences.

Many hosting services actually rely on a major host of their own. These types of companies buy huge blocks of web server capacity at a bulk discount, then re-sell it in smaller chunks to individual web site owners. Research the background on your site’s host, and determine which provider will give you the lowest price for comparable services, especially when provided by the same servers.

If you want to draw more traffic with your site, choose a web host with a solid SEO feature. This feature often allows you to streamline the process necessary to add your website to major search engines. If you are concerned with custom content, though, you may be better suited to add this information manually. Oftentimes, automated SEO services will not allow for personalized descriptions.

How will you contact your hosting provider in times of crisis? If you find that you can contact them via a live chat, email or phone support on a 24 hour basis 7 days a week, it means that they have pretty good customer service. This saves you many headaches if something happens.
